The Qatar Airways Group has announced the appointment of Hamad Ali Al-Khater as its new Group Chief Executive Officer, a move effective immediately. This leadership change is part of the airline’s strategic plan to expand its global network and enhance operational excellence.
Al-Khater brings extensive experience from Qatar’s aviation and energy sectors, having most recently served as Chief Operating Officer at Hamad International Airport. His background indicates an emphasis on operational performance and passenger experience, aligning with Qatar Airways’ focus on service quality.
Earlier this year, Qatar Airways received the prestigious World’s Best Airline award from the World Airline Awards, reinforcing its reputation as a leading carrier. The airline's leadership transition reflects its ambition to build on this success and pursue future growth opportunities.
"Qatar Airways Group extends its appreciation to Engr. Badr Mohammed Al-Meer for his service," stated Saad Sherida Al-Kaabi, the group's Chairman. "As we welcome Mr. Al-Khater, we look forward to strengthening our global reach and delivering world-class experiences to travelers worldwide."
